      Engineering educators face unique challenges when teaching online classes, especially when the course incorporates experimental activities. In this study, the effects have been investigated of using new laboratory activities in both onsite and online engineering classes. First class incorporated ELVIS (Educational Laboratory Virtual Instrumentation Suite) equipment to introduce online students to electrical circuit laboratory activities. Second class incorporated Emona DATEx (Digital Analog Telecommunications Experimenter) in new laboratory activities in onsite classes that previously did not use any labs. Qualitative and quantitative assessment data show that students like this system and rated it very highly as a new educational tool.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
